Lotions/ Creams -Paula's Choice - Weightless Body Treatment with 2% BHA
ocicat 11/4/2006 4:59:00 AM
have been using this for a yr or two now and love it. use it on my face (not around eyes) esp nose and chin coz BHA is better for unclogging pores. i use the AHA lotion on legs- AHA is better for dry skin and ingrown hairs. this is more gentle than the AHA which can sting esp after shaving and on irritated skin. not fragranced or coloured. great!

Lotions/ Creams -Paula's Choice - RESIST Skin Revealing 10% AHA Lotion
ocicat 11/4/2006 4:57:00 AM
i've been using this stuff for abt 2 yrs and love it. i use it after every shower (or alternate it with ordinary moistriser). it keeps my skin bump-free and reduces ingrown hairs. the smell doesnt bother me much- its a bit sour, but thats coz she chose not to add over powering fragrance to cover up the natural smell. i even use it on my face sparingly (her products are ok to use on body and face, as long as u avoid sensitive areas eg around eyes). i didnt realise how much a difference this stuff makes until a few months ago when i stopped using it and used normal msoitruiser. then all my ingrown bumps came back. since then, i've used it religiously!

Lip Gloss -DuWop - Lip Venom
ocicat 11/2/2006 3:08:00 AM
Was initially good - tingly and warm feel, nice light cinnamon scent. But it works by the cinnamon oil stimulating the skin - and thats not a good thing because its a skin irritant. I found out for myself when used over time, it made my lips dry and sore. it's actually dehydrating to keep using. packaging is bad too - too liquidy to only have a twist top lid and not a smaller hole or something to flow out from. over time, bits of dirt built up under the lid. pricey. not worth it. eroh, and didnt really make my lips pinker or bigger - it just felt that way (and looking fuller as any shiny gloss would do, but no more).
